A woman assessing a property for real estate investment discovered two dogs without shelter in the backyard, one of which was severely underweight in Oklahoma City.
During an inquiry, the police located a significantly emaciated Weimaraner in the backyard and brought it to the vet along with the owners. According to court records, the owners became confrontational, and the vet retained the dog because they were unable to pay.
Investigators revealed that the dog owners had received fines and warnings from animal welfare on multiple occasions. Presently, Dustin McClure is in jail facing charges of animal cruelty, and Tabitha McClure, his wife, has also been charged.
